The local Clearwater, Florida Fox affiliate featured rebuilding efforts of the community of Holy Trinity Greek Orthodox Church, which suffered a devastating fire last February in their Faith in Action series (see video below).
Structural damage and smoke destroyed the inside of the building. It was a Saturday night when the fire took place but quick action enabled the community to worship the very next day in a nearby gymnasium.
Immediately after the incident, the community came together to raise millions and starting the rebuilding process.
Renderings in the video below show that very soon, an 11,500 Byzantine-style sanctuary will be built and ready to welcome worshipers once again. A capital campaign was undertaken, already having raised more than $4 million.
Holy Trinity in Clearwater serves more than 900 families from the region.
